Explore the Magic of Ubud

Ubud is the cultural heart of Bali, blending nature, art, and adventure into a single unforgettable destination. Surrounded by rice terraces, lush jungles, and sacred temples, this charming town offers countless ways to explore and experience Balinese life.

Whether you’re seeking art, relaxation, or adrenaline-pumping adventure, Ubud has something special for everyone. Here are some of the best things to do in Ubud that will make your trip truly memorable.


🌾 1. Visit the Tegallalang Rice Terrace

Enjoy the breathtaking views of Tegallalang Rice Terrace, one of Bali’s most iconic landscapes. Walk through the terraced fields, sip coffee at a hillside café, and capture stunning photos surrounded by natural beauty.


🐒 2. Explore the Sacred Monkey Forest

The Sacred Monkey Forest Sanctuary offers a mix of nature, history, and playful wildlife. Meet friendly macaques and stroll under ancient banyan trees while discovering hidden temples.


🎭 3. Watch a Traditional Dance Show

Experience Bali’s rich culture through Legong or Barong dance performances at the Ubud Palace. The music, costumes, and storytelling bring Balinese traditions to life.


🖼️ 4. Shop at the Ubud Art Market

The Ubud Art Market is perfect for finding handmade crafts, paintings, and souvenirs made by local artisans. Bargain politely and bring home a piece of Balinese creativity.


💦 5. Go on an ATV Adventure

For thrill-seekers, ATV rides in Ubud offer an unforgettable off-road experience. Ride through rice fields, muddy trails, and bamboo forests while soaking in Bali’s rural charm — a fun way to explore the countryside beyond the main roads.


🌊 6. Experience White Water Rafting

Challenge yourself with an exhilarating white-water rafting tour along the Ayung River. Paddle through scenic gorges and waterfalls surrounded by tropical jungle — one of the most exciting adventure activities near Ubud.


💧 7. Visit Tegenungan Waterfall

Cool off at Tegenungan Waterfall, located just a short drive from Ubud’s center. You can swim, relax by the river, or simply enjoy the sound of falling water in a lush tropical setting.


🧘 8. Join a Yoga or Wellness Retreat

Ubud is known worldwide for its yoga centers and holistic retreats. Whether you’re a beginner or advanced yogi, the peaceful surroundings are perfect for relaxation and self-discovery.


🍽️ 9. Try Authentic Balinese Cuisine

Taste local favorites like Babi Guling, Bebek Betutu, and Lawar at traditional warungs or restaurants with rice field views.


🌺 Discover the Spirit of Ubud

From adventure and art to spirituality and relaxation, Ubud invites every traveler to experience the true essence of Bali. No matter how long you stay, each moment will connect you deeper with the island’s beauty and culture.
